Job Description:

The Sommelier is responsible for managing the resort’s wine and specialty beverage offerings, ensuring expert, personalized, and high‑level service. Their mission is to elevate the guest’s dining experience through professional recommendations, efficient cellar management, and ongoing training for the service team.

Job Responsibility:

  • Provide expert wine guidance — including pairings, premium beverages, and personalized recommendations aligned with guest preferences and each outlet’s menu
  • Ensure exceptional service execution — proper wine temperatures, correct glassware, prompt handling of special requests, and warm, knowledgeable guest interaction
  • Oversee full wine cellar management — inventory control, cost monitoring, product availability, storage standards, and maintaining an organized, secure cellar
  • Drive wine program performance — strategic sales management, menu curation, trend evaluation, supplier coordination, and maintaining a competitive, high‑quality wine portfolio
  • Train and support the service team — conducting wine education, reinforcing standards during service, and leading tastings, pairings, and special wine events

Requirements:

  • Fluency in Spanish and English (spoken and written)
  • Minimum 3 years of experience in Food & Beverage, preferably in a supervisory or department‑head capacity
  • Minimum 2 years of experience in a luxury hotel or similar high‑end dining environment
  • Previous Sommelier experience or similar roles within Food & Beverage
  • Strong knowledge of Micros
  • familiarity with Opera is an asset
  • Knowledge of food safety standards, health regulations, and responsible alcohol service
  • Basic understanding of financial principles (labor cost, P&L, inventory, cost control)
  • Proficiency in operating standard computer systems and POS platforms
  • Professional wine certifications such as Court of Master Sommeliers, WSET, or equivalent
  • In‑depth knowledge of wine regions, varietals, winemaking processes, and global market trends
  • Understanding of food pairing principles, gastronomy, basic mixology, and international wine portfolios
